ZNAČAJ PRIMENE KVANTITATIVNOG SENZORNOG TESTIRANJA KOD PACIJENATA SA HRONIČNIM MUSKULOSKELETNIM BOLOM
Sažetak
Kvantitativno senzorno testiranje (engl. quantitatory sensory testing ‒ QST) pruža objektivne, ponovljive podatke koji mogu pomoći u potvrđivanju dijagnoze ili u praćenju ishoda lečenja kod pacijenata sa hroničnim muskuloskeletnim bolom (engl. chronic musculoskeletal pain ‒ CMSP). QST može otkriti rane senzorne promene pre nego što one postanu klinički očigledne. Budući da QST procedure nisu invazivne, pogodne su za ponovljene procene i dugotrajno praćenje. Standardizacija protokola testiranja od ključnog je značaja za dobijanje pouzdanih rezultata. Oslabljena modulacija bola uslovljena kondicioniranjem (engl. conditioned pain modulation ‒ CPM) mogla bi poslužiti kao biomarker za centralnu senzitizaciju u hroničnim bolnim stanjima i pomoći kliničarima da identifikuju pacijente čiji je bol centralno posredovan. QST ima potencijala da postane sastavni deo rutinskih kliničkih evaluacija u različitim hroničnim mišićno-skeletnim stanjima. QST je posebno značajan u proceni efekta fizikalnih terapija, programa vežbi i psihološke terapije.
